Black Maria

In real, traceable use. Part of the curated seed collection; community review is coming.

Sense 1

Meaning · English

A police van for transporting prisoners.

Register: slang

Where it’s used: Used American English

Examples

The Upper Ten Thousand have plenty of cash— At the Central Park, on the “Drive,” cut a dash; They have their light wagons, fast horses beside; In the free “Black Maria” the Lower Ten ride.

Sense 2

Meaning · English

the sombre van in which prisoners are conveyed from the police court to prison.

Era: ca. 1874 (Victorian)

Where it’s used: Origin British & Irish English
